Business grants Australia, a form of financial assistance that doesn’t require any form of repayment, works to benefit both the grantor (usually the Australian government) and the receiver (the ‘grantee’). For the receiver, they are given the opportunity to undertake economic growth plans for the business without the ardent financial concerns. For the grantor, business grants Australia support business ventures that in return, grow Australia’s economic viability, which creates sustained future growth and development keeping Australia strong in weak international financial market conditions.

Locating Australian Business Grants
There are hundreds of different types of business grants in Australia that are available at all federal, state, local council and private levels. On the federal level, business grants in Australia can cater for all small, medium & larger businesses which will benefit the nation as a whole, whereas on the state, local & private levels, business grants in Australia tend to have smaller funding budgets and focus more towards the small and medium businesses that will collectively assist the state and nation’s overall economy.
